Description

Glazed earthenware. Numbered 836 (1896-97). Turner/former signature indistinct. Ø 25 cm.

Helmer Osslund was hired by Höganäsbolaget for the 1897 Art and Industry Exhibition. He designed some 70 models, of which at least a dozen were exhibited. The reception was a success, there was talk of Osslund as a bold experimental ceramicist, influenced by the artists he had met shortly before in Paris, Paul Gauguin and the Dane Jens Ferdinand Willumsen. However, the success did not concern Osslund who, after this isolated effort, left the pottery to return to painting. /MP
